Please read. "Lost Sectors" missed oppourtunity

Bungie had a bunch of missed opportunities with D2. First, I'd like to point out lost sectors. Well, I guess I can't really call them lost sectors since their marked on my map, it appears they're not really lost. Rather than having 5-25 "lost" sectors per map, depending on planet and size, each planet should have had 4-6 LOST sectors. These lost sectors should have been very well hidden, almost to the point where some you just have to happen upon. These lost sectors would grant, by RNG, the possibility of gear. Let me talk about the gear quick. Since each planet has an enemy race that is more prevalent, each planet would have a full set of gear for each class (Titan, Warlock, and Hunter). The pieces of the gear sets would only be obtainable from the chests at the end of the the lost sectors, based off RNG. Sometimes you'd get tokens, but there is a chance for the race specific loot. So this would give credibility as to why there's a swarm of enemies guarding a chest. I mean, let's be honest, I don't think the enemy would be guarding chests of tokens which have absolutely no worth to them. I mean, unless the fallen are gonna go hit up Devrim for a shiny piece of green gear. But, I doubt it. Now, since the amount of lost sectors have been reduced by about 50-70%, we can add some substance to these sectors. Give them story, why are they there? How did they form? Give them mechanics to get to the end of the lost sector. When they were first introduced, they were made to sound like they were gonna be some great feat. But, the truth was discovered in the first week of D2. Run past all the adds then pump the the yellow bar full of power ammo. What should have been epic adventures ended up being patrols inside caves with no story or reason for why we're raiding them. Now back to the design, like I said, give them mechanics, multiple areas of the sectors, maybe keys we need to discover to unlocks doors to even proceed further. Make the boss an actual boss, it doesn't need to be anything crazy but it should make the fight feel fun, not like a chore for a mediocre reward. And finally, each enemy race should have a race specific weapon which would be obtainable through a separate quest. This quest would be obtainable from these chests by way of RNG. By way of doing Lost Sectors this way, would have added a lot more replay-ability. Btw, I thought of this idea in about 10 minutes, your move Bungie. P.S. Thought of this after typing everything. Each planet should have a planet specific shader which would also drop from the lost sector chests. TL:DR Lost sectors were a fail. Should have been like mini strikes. Should have enemy race specific gear sets for each class and one weapon per enemy race, obtainable by the chests in the lost sectors.       A lot of wasted potential in this game. Lots of things that could have been implemented, or improved upon, had Bungie just taken the time... The Armor/Weapon mod system, the Lost Sectors, the Adventures, the Exotics, the quest weapons, the static weapon rolls, the class-specific swords you get after completing the campaign, and so on. All of these could have been way better, but Bungie dropped the ball, as usual. They couldn't even be bothered to create unique armor and weapons for the Factions. Dead Orbit could have had a Fallen/Hive theme, new Monarchy could have had regal-looking, or Cabal themed, armor and weapons, and Future War Cult could have had Vex themed gear with hologram class items. What's worse is that a lot of--if not all--the improvements that were made in Destiny 1 have been just thrown out the window in Destiny 2. Heroic Strikes, Strike-Specific gear, private matches, Crucible game modes, etc. They've taken a step backwards, and even removed things no one asked to be removed, like ammo synths, and being able to buy legendary gear from the vendors. Instead they've opted for more RNG, as if they completely forgot how much players dislike the constant RNG. It's just a lazy way to extend play time.
